**Veolia Water Technologies & Solutions (VWTS) is on the move and we’re looking for a skilled bilingual Human Resources (HR) Manager located either in Ontario or Quebec, Canada. This position will partner with our North America Projects business unit to support internal client needs across NAM that help drive people success. The HR Manager position builds good business partnerships and displays a consistent passion for people and commitment to supporting internal clients. You’ll need to influence leaders and understand both broad business issues and regional-specific challenges to enable the workforce to meet business objectives.**

**Key Responsibilities**:

- **You’ll guide the development and execution of workforce strategies in collaboration with HR leadership, human resources team and operations’ leadership. We also want you to be a contributing strategic member of the HR Team.**
- **A deep understanding of the business is key You’ll need to participate in client activities to build knowledge of the operational objectives and the culture of assigned regions. This includes attending client meetings to give HR updates and receive updates on operational needs and changes while also looking for new opportunities and solutions to deliver HR support in line with business goals.**
- **Supporting management efforts in workforce planning is key, as is monitoring trends such as turnover and time to fill to support clients with staffing challenges. You’ll work closely with recruitment colleagues and management groups to identify and remove barriers to filling positions. Participation in the recruitment process may be necessary from time to time**
- **Employee engagement and training is critical We’ll need you to help deliver new employee orientation, management education and supervisor skills development courses.**
- **We’re data driven You’ll need to leverage data to identify opportunities for improvement in a number of key workforce areas.**
- **You’ll participate in various activities related to employee relations to include conflict resolution, providing counselling to managers and employees of low to high complexity, and conducting interviews. Works with client managers and staff to coach, train and guide in regards to employee relations, policy interpretation, procedures, benefits, compensation, job description development, payroll, turnover, employee satisfaction, performance management, conflict resolution, and legal issues.**
- **When issues arise, you’ll need to participate in investigations for a variety of issues including local government agency concerns, business practice complaints, and Unemployment Claims. Identifies appropriate options for management/senior leadership consideration, makes recommendations as necessary, and writes summary reports to support employment-related business decisions.**
- **You will also need to be fluent with compensation policy and able to give counsel/ recommendations to management - advise management on handling crucial compensation conversations. Identifies business cases that support the compensation model and partners with compensation colleagues for a joint solution.**
